    How to Make Light & Fluffy Yogurt Cake

    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:

    Step 1: Preheat & Prep

    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 9×13 inch baking pan. This prevents sticking and ensures easy removal.

    Step 2: Dry Ingredients

    In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Make sure everything is well combined to avoid lumps.

    Step 3: Wet Ingredients

    In a separate bowl, whisk together the yogurt, oil, Alcohol-free alcohol-free alcohol-free alcohol-free vanilla extract, lemon juice, and eggs until smooth. This ensures even distribution of the wet ingredients.

    Step 4: Combine Wet and Dry

    Gradually add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ients, mixing gently until just combined. Overmixing can lead to a tough cake, so be careful.

    Step 5: Bake

    Pour the batter into the prepared pan and bake for 30-35 minutes,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.

    Step 6: Cool & Serve

    Let the cake cool in the pan for 10 minutes before inverting it onto a wire rack to cool completely. Once cool, dust with powdered sugar or serve with fresh berries. Enjoy!

    Tips for Light & Fluffy Perfection

    Remember, the key to a truly light and fluffy yogurt cake lies in a few simple tricks. Don’t overmix the batter – this is a recipe for gentle blending. Use room temperature ingredients for even baking. And lastly, don’t open the oven door too frequently while baking, as this can cause the cake to collapse.

    Light & Fluffy Yogurt Cake

    5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star

    3.5 from 38 reviews

    Delicious light & fluffy yogurt cake recipe with detailed instructions and nutritional information.

    • Total Time: 35 minutes
    • Yield: 4 servings 1x

    Ingredients

    Scale
    • 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
    • 1 ½ teaspoons baking powder
    • ¼ teaspoon baking soda
    • ¼ teaspoon salt
    • ½ cup (1 stick) unsalted butter, softened
    • 1 ¾ cups granulated sugar
    • 2 large eggs
    •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
    • 1 cup plain yogurt (full-fat recommended)

    Instructions

    1. Step 1: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 9×13 inch baking pan.
    2. Step 2: In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Set aside.
    3. Step 3: In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in eggs one at a time, then stir in the vanilla extract.
    4. Step 4: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, alternating with the yogurt, beginning and ending with the dry ingredients. Mix until just combined; do not overmix.
    5. Step 5: Pour batter into the prepared pan and bake for 30-35 minutes,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.
    6. Step 6: Let the cake cool in the pan for 10 minutes before inverting it onto a wire rack to cool completely.

    Notes

    • Store leftover cake in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days, or freeze for longer storage.
    • For a warm, comforting treat, gently reheat a slice in the microwave for 15-20 seconds or until heated through.
    • Serve this cake with a dollop of fresh whipped cream and a sprinkle of berries for an extra touch of sweetness and elegance.
    • To achieve maximum fluffiness, make sure your butter is truly softened and your eggs are at room temperature before creaming them together with the sugar.

    FAQs

    Can I use a different type of yogurt for this Light & Fluffy Yogurt Cake?

    Absolutely! This recipe is pretty forgiving. Greek yogurt will give you a slightly denser cake, while regular yogurt will result in a lighter, fluffier texture. You can even experiment with flavored yogurts, just remember to adjust the sugar accordingly – you might need less if your yogurt is already sweet. Just make sure your yogurt is plain or at least not overly tart. The tang can easily overpower the other flavors in this light and fluffy cake.

    How can I make this Light & Fluffy Yogurt Cake even more moist?

    For an extra-moist cake, consider adding a little extra liquid. You can increase the amount of yogurt slightly, or add a tablespoon or two of milk (dairy or non-dairy). Another trick is to brush the warm cake with a simple syrup made from equal parts water and sugar once it’s out of the oven. This will help trap moisture and keep your cake wonderfully soft for days. This enhances the light and fluffy texture.

    Is it possible to make this Light & Fluffy Yogurt Cake ahead of time?

    Yes! This cake is great made a day or two in advance. Store it airtight at room temperature for up to two days, or in the refrigerator for up to four. It actually tastes even better the next day, as the flavors have a chance to meld together nicely. If you’re making it well in advance and storing in the fridge, remember to let it come to room temperature before serving for the best texture and enjoyment of this light and fluffy cake.

    My Light & Fluffy Yogurt Cake is slightly dry, what went wrong?

    A dry cake often means you’ve overbaked it! Next time, check for doneness a few minutes earlier than the recipe suggests. A toothpick inserted into the center should come out with just a few moist crumbs attached, not wet batter. Make sure your oven temperature is accurate; an oven that runs too hot can also lead to dryness. Always use a reliable oven thermometer to ensure accuracy. Remember, a light and fluffy yogurt cake is all about getting the baking time just right.
